Sapphire Foods India Limited (SAPPHIRE) — Working Capital to Net Assets Ratio
Sapphire Foods India Limited (SAPPHIRE) has a Working Capital to Net Assets ratio of -14.3% as of March 2026. Working capital of Rs-1.99 Billion (current assets of Rs3.38 Billion minus current liabilities of Rs5.38 Billion) is measured against net assets of Rs13.89 Billion. A higher ratio indicates strong short-term liquidity financed by the equity base. Annual Working Capital to Net Assets for Sapphire Foods India Limited (2018–2026)
The table below presents the year-by-year Working Capital to Net Assets ratio for Sapphire Foods India Limited from 2018 to 2026, covering 9 annual filings. Each row shows current assets, current liabilities, working capital, net assets, the ratio, and the change in percentage points compared to the prior year. | Year | WC/NA Ratio | Working Capital (INR) | Net Assets | Current Assets | Current Liabilities | Change (pp) |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2026 | -14.3% | Rs-1.99 Billion | Rs13.89 Billion | Rs3.38 Billion | Rs5.38 Billion | ▼ -11.8 pp |
| 2025 | -2.6% | Rs-360.64 Million | Rs13.96 Billion | Rs4.23 Billion | Rs4.59 Billion | ▲ +3.5 pp |
| 2024 | -6.1% | Rs-811.79 Million | Rs13.40 Billion | Rs3.63 Billion | Rs4.44 Billion | ▼ -2.8 pp |
| 2023 | -3.3% | Rs-411.11 Million | Rs12.54 Billion | Rs4.93 Billion | Rs5.34 Billion | ▼ -17.5 pp |
| 2022 | 14.3% | Rs1.43 Billion | Rs10.05 Billion | Rs5.91 Billion | Rs4.47 Billion | ▲ +49.1 pp |
| 2021 | -34.8% | Rs-1.67 Billion | Rs4.79 Billion | Rs1.44 Billion | Rs3.10 Billion | ▼ -3.9 pp |
| 2020 | -30.9% | Rs-1.62 Billion | Rs5.25 Billion | Rs1.17 Billion | Rs2.79 Billion | ▲ +51.5 pp |
| 2019 | -82.4% | Rs-3.32 Billion | Rs4.03 Billion | Rs2.62 Billion | Rs5.94 Billion | ▼ -33.9 pp |
| 2018 | -48.5% | Rs-2.31 Billion | Rs4.77 Billion | Rs971.11 Million | Rs3.28 Billion | — |
